Third Schafalpenkopf

The Third Schafalpenkopf, Highest Schafalpenkopf or Northeastern Schafalpenkopf is a 2,320-metre-high mountain in the . It is part of the Mindelheimer Klettersteig.
  • Type: Peak with an elevation of 2,321 metres
  • Description: mountain of the Allgäu Alps at the border of Bavaria, Germany, and Vorarlberg, Austria
  • Also known as: Dritter Schafalpenkopf”, “Nördlicher Schafalpenkopf”, and “Northern Schafalpenkopf
